Work Detail
1. The Subject Of The Order Is To Carry Out Periodic Inspection Of The Technical Condition Of The Electrical And Lightning Protection Installations In Terms Of Protection Measures Against Electric Shocks, Insulation Resistance Of Wires And Grounding Of Installations And Devices In The Buildings Of The Faculty Of Mechanical Technology - Streets: Ludwika Narbutta 85, Ludwika Narbutta 86 And Konwiktorska 2 In Warsaw.2. As Part Of The Inspection, The Ordering Party Expects The Contractor To Prepare Reports On The Technical Condition Of The Electrical And Lightning Protection Installations For Each Building Separately.3. Checking Protection Against Electric Shock Applies To Basic Protection (Protection Against Direct Contact) And Protection Against Damage (Protection Against Indirect Contact).4. The Subject Of The Order Includes The Electrical Distribution And Receiving Installation (Main Lv Switchgears, Multi-Story Switchboards - Zone, Area, Shaft And Dedicated, Wlz-Ts, Power Supply Circuits) And The Lightning Protection Installation.5. The Scope Of The Technical Inspection Includes: 1) Cutting Off The Power Supply To The Attic With Protection. 2) Replacing Fuses If They Need To Be Replaced. 3) Measurements Of Short-Circuit Loop Impedance For The Entire Installation In The Building. 4) Measurements Of The Operation Of Residual Current Circuit Breakers For The Entire Installation In The Building. 5) Measurements Of The Insulation Resistance Of Electrical Circuits In The Entire Building. 6) Measurements Of The Grounding Of The Electrical Installation In The Entire Building. 7) Measurements Of The Ground Resistance Lightning Protection.8) Inspection Of Switchboards With A Thermal Imaging Camera And Maintenance. 9) Checking The Operation Of Fire Protection Switches. 10) Partial Inventory Of The Electrical Installation In The Building, Including A Description Of Switchboards And Sockets. 11) Preparing A Block Diagram Of The Buildings Power Supply. 12) Preparing Post-Inspection Reports. 6. Checking The Effectiveness Of Protection Against Electric Shock In Basic And Emergency Lighting Circuits Should Be Performed For The First Luminaire In The Circuit.7. Within The Scope Of These Works, The Contractor Is Responsible For Making An Entry About The Inspection Carried Out In The Building Facility Book In Accordance With Art. 62B Section 1 Of The Construction Law And Preparation Of A General Protocol - A Decision On The Condition Of The Installation, Which Is An Annex To The Construction Book.8. Within The Scope Of This Work, The Contractor Is Responsible For Notifying The Competent Construction Supervision Authority About The Inspection Carried Out In Accordance With Art. 62B Section 2 Of The Construction Law. Notice Must Be Given In Writing.9. A Detailed Description And Method Of Execution Of The Order Is Included In The Description Of The Subject Of The Order (Opz), Constituting Annex No. 6 To The Swz.
